PM Narendra Modi to take oath of office on May 30 at 7 pm
News Nation Bureau 26 May 2019, 07:08 PM
After spectacular win of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P)-led NDA in this Lok Sabha elections, Narendra Modi is all set to be sworn-in as the prime minister of India for the second consecutive term on May 30 at 7 pm.
